Introduction to Dimensional Analysis Inquiry Activity

Dimensional Analysis and Stoichiometry can be difficult concepts for students. This activity is scaffolded so that any learner can be successful! The students will start off with shapes and pictures that allows the content to feel relatable, and then ultimately move onto dimensional analysis calculations. This activity should be used to help students understand the process of dimensional analysis before jumping into stoichiometry problems. This document is editable to suit your classroom needs and is ESL friendly!
